This tour includes a trip to three cities - Delhi, Agra and Jaipur, besides these three cities tourists can visit tiger parks (Ranthambore National Park) also.

The golden Triangle with tiger starts from Delhi which is the capital of India and home to a number of cultural and historical sites that never ever fail to attract the tourists coming to India. In the magnificent and charming Old Delhi and New Delhi, there are a number of places to explore such as Red Fort (Lal Quila), Moti Masjid, Chandini Chowk, Raj ghat Humayun's tomb, Jama Masjid, Raj Path, Qutub Minar, Jantar Mantar and many more. After visiting Delhi, visitors can explore Agra which is home to Taj Mahal and situated on the bank of Yamuna River. The Taj Mahal is one of the Seven Wonders of the World and the symbol of true and eternal love. Here, visitors can explore many attractive places like Agra fort, Fatehpur Sikari, Atmat-Ud-Daulah, Chini ka Rauza, Sikandra and some others.

After exploring Agra, tourists can visit Jaipur with golden triangle tiger. Jaipur is the capital of Rajasthan and known as the pink city. The city of Jaipur is the most prominent and perfect place to experience the cultural philosophy of Rajasthan. Here, tourists can visit many good-looking attractions such as Hawa Mahal, Jantar Mantar, Jal Mahal, Amber Fort, City Palace, Kanak Valley, Jaigarh Fort, Govind Temple, Laxmi Narayan and many more.

After visiting these three destinations visitors can explore Ranthambore National Park which is few kms away from Jaipur. Ranthambore National Park is prominent tiger treasury in the country parks. This park is situated in the Sawai Madhopur district in Rajasthan which was established in 1955.  Ranthambore National Park was known as the Project Tiger reserve in 1973. With golden triangle with tiger, tourists can explore some of the most famous wildlife species like wild boar, chital, jackal, Indian Hare, porcupines, monitor lizard, sambhar, gazzelle, gaur, black buck etc.
